Personalized Assistance with Daily Living Activities

Staff in Haverford’s assisted living communities are specially trained to support residents with essential activities of daily living (ADLs) while empowering them to remain as independent as possible. These activities include:

  • Bathing and grooming
  • Dressing
  • Mobility and transfers
  • Medication management
  • Meal preparation and assistance

By offering gentle, respectful support, team members allow residents to start each day refreshed and ready to enjoy all that Haverford has to offer. Promoting Wellness and Managing Health

Health management is a cornerstone of assisted living. Staff coordinate wellness programs that cater to the unique needs of Haverford seniors:

  • Scheduling and reminding residents of medical appointments—often at nearby Main Line Health centers
  • Conducting routine wellness checks and monitoring chronic conditions
  • Arranging on-site therapy sessions, fitness classes, and yoga tailored to seniors
  • Collaborating with local healthcare professionals

These services ensure residents have easy access to high-quality healthcare without sacrificing the comfort and peace of suburban Haverford living.

The Pennsylvania Assisted Living Association (PALA) is the only statewide organization dedicated exclusively to supporting assisted living residences and personal care homes across Pennsylvania, focusing strongly on the individuals and families who rely on these services. PALA advocates for safe, affordable, high-quality, person-centered care that promotes dignity, independence, and informed choice, while working with state agencies and policymakers to strengthen standards, protect resident rights, and enhance the quality of life throughout the Commonwealth.
